Scandia property taxes going up
Cliff Buchan
News Editor
Residents of the new city of Scandia can expect to pay higher property taxes under a preliminary tax levy plan approved last week.
Meeting in special session on Tuesday, Sept. 11, the Scandia City Council approved the preliminary 2008 tax levy, increasing the total city property tax levy by a maximum of 11.06 percent from 2007 to 2008 (from $1,533,930 to $1,703,589.)
The final levy amount will be determined in December, after the Monday, Dec. 3 Truth in Taxation public hearing and the Tuesday, Dec. 18 budget adoption hearing, at which citizens are invited to comment on the proposed property tax levy.
The city’s operating budget is expected to increase by 2.02 percent from 2007 to 2008.
Inflation factor
City Administrator Anne Hurlburt said the increase is less than the rate of inflation, even as some costs are increasing faster.
For example, the police services contract with Washington County will increase by 12.02 percent, she said. Health insurance costs will go up 17.6 percent.
The tax increase is more than the operating budget increase because other revenues (interest, permit fees, state aid) are down she added. Also, a large part of Scandia’s resources are spent on road paving projects, including debt service.
The 6 percent growth in taxable property value from 2007 to 2008 absorbs some of the levy increase, so the tax rate would increase at a slower rate than the levy (4.67 percent), the administrator said.
The proposed 2008 tax rate of 25.116 percent is less than the New Scandia Township tax rates for 2005 (28.036 percent) and 2006 (26.551 percent.) City property taxes on the average value home in Scandia ($391,700 in 2008) would increase by a maximum of 6.15 percent ($56.61.)
Part (about one-fourth) of this increase is due to an increase in the average home value, which was $387,000 in 2007, she said.
Scandia has consistently ranked low for municipal property tax burden compared to other Metropolitan Area communities, Hurlburt said.
In 2006, Scandia ranked 82nd among 113 cities and towns above 2300 population.
